首页源码oracledeclare(oracle declare)

oracledeclare(oracle declare)

编程之家 2023-08-21 260次浏览

如果你对oracledeclare感兴趣,或者正面临与oracle declare相关的问题,那么千万别错过编程之家站!立即开始阅读,掌握这些有用的技巧!

oracledeclare(oracle declare)

请问一下Oracle存储过程中声明变量一定要declare吗

1、你在写存储过程的时候就按照语法 CREATE OR REPLACE PROCEDURE P_NAME IS BEGIN END P_NAME; 就行了,但是你要是在SQL window或者command window中调试一段代码的话,就要用declare声明。

2、在函数、过程、包的申明部分定义变量时,可以不用Declare,但使用匿名程序时,一定要使用Declare定义变量;纯SQL语句是不用begin/end的。只有PL/SQL语句才使用。

3、如果你是说sql server的话, 外部传入的不用declare,系统已有的不用declare(这部分具体可以上网下载sqlserver online help 参阅),其他都要。

oracledeclare(oracle declare)

4、应该在前面声明变量区域加入这两个变量的声明信息,如:DECLARE UserRoleID int DECLARE StrError varchar(64)当然,变量的数据类型不一定是int和varchar(64),要根据实际情况确定。加入上述声明语句之后,请再进行测试。

在《oracle》中如何用declare声明变量?

1、\x0d\x0a声明块中的变量,只需要在块里面的最前面输入声明即可。

2、on [TEST1@orcl#15-4月 -10] SQLdeclare 2 v_num number;3 begin 4 select count(*) into v_num from tab;5 dbms_output.put_line(v_num);6 end;7 / 15 PL/SQL 过程已成功完成。

oracledeclare(oracle declare)

3、declare age number(4);--声明一个参数a,类型为number,类型长度为4,操作方法如下:首先在oracle数据库中,应用%type类型读取订单信息表中 ,购买的订单的总金额和订单数量。

oracle里面declare怎么用?

1、先说一下你的问题,declare在oracle中指代的是“块”,用于处理一段业务逻辑的。声明块中的变量,只需要在块里面的最前面输入声明即可。

2、declare age number(4);--声明一个参数a,类型为number,类型长度为4,操作方法如下:首先在oracle数据库中,应用%type类型读取订单信息表中 ,购买的订单的总金额和订单数量。

3、如果没有返回值就是函数,如果有返回值,就是存储过程。存储过程是编译后存在数据库里面的。只能说是在command里面编译。就是用begin end界定一个代码块,跟C语言中的{}是同一个意思。比如CREATE Procedure()as begin 。

4、具体如下:第一步,创建一个新的存储过程,见下图,转到下面的步骤。第二步,完成上述步骤后,修改存储过程。

5、新建一个存储过程(Procedure)。修改存储过程,这个存储过程有一个输入参数(pid)跟一个输出参数(name),即通过用户id查询用户名称并将名称返回。调试存储过程,找到刚刚创建的存储过程右击并点击【test】选项。

oracledeclare
赣州网站优化(赣州网站优化设计招聘) redhat5.5 redhat55DNS主从复制传送